No RMDs. In contrast to traditional IRAs, Roth IRAs don’t require you to make withdrawals from your when you get to age seventy three. That means your money can grow tax-free for as long as you’d like, even when you’ve strike retirement age.

In addition to transfer fees, there may be other fees linked with holding a gold IRA, like storage fees for keeping the gold coins safe, transaction fees for buying or selling the gold, and administrative fees for your custodian.

Tax-free growth for heirs. Beneficiaries are required to withdraw the money from a Roth IRA that they inherit within a decade of the initial account proprietor’s Dying. But as opposed to with a traditional IRA, Individuals beneficiaries don’t have to pay taxes on All those withdrawals.

Tax-free withdrawals. Contributions to Roth IRAs are made with article-tax dollars. Once you hit age 59 ½ and you’ve had your Roth IRA open for at least five years, it is possible to withdraw your money without paying any penalty over the contributions or earnings. That could be a major additionally for folks in a variety of financial cases, but it makes a Roth IRA Specifically attractive when you’re likely to be in a greater tax bracket when you withdraw your money than you currently are.
